excel表中怎么按姓名进行排序

excel表中怎么按姓名进行排序

在Excel表中按姓名进行排序的方法主要包括:使用排序功能、应用自定义排序、使用公式辅助、利用数据透视表等。 其中,使用排序功能是最常见且简便的方法。通过Excel内置的排序工具,可以快速地将数据按姓名进行升序或降序排列,以下将详细介绍这一方法。


一、使用排序功能

Excel的排序功能是最常见的排序工具,能够快速、便捷地对姓名列进行排序。以下是具体步骤:

  1. 选择数据范围

    • 首先,打开Excel表格,选择包含要排序的姓名列的整个数据范围。确保选择的范围包括所有相关的列,以防数据错位。
  2. 打开排序对话框

    • 在“数据”选项卡中,点击“排序”按钮,打开“排序”对话框。
  3. 设置排序条件

    • 在“排序依据”下拉列表中选择姓名列。
    • 选择排序方式,如“A到Z”或“Z到A”。
    • 点击“确定”进行排序。

详细描述:这一步通过使用Excel内置的排序功能,可以快速将数据按姓名列进行排序。选择数据范围时,确保所有相关列都包含在内,避免数据错位导致的错误。通过设置排序条件,可以选择按字母升序或降序排列,方便管理和查找数据。

二、应用自定义排序

有时候,可能需要根据特定的顺序来排序姓名列,此时可以使用自定义排序功能。

  1. 打开排序对话框

    • 在“数据”选项卡中,点击“排序”按钮,打开“排序”对话框。
  2. 选择自定义排序

    • 在“排序依据”下拉列表中选择姓名列。
    • 点击“自定义序列”按钮。
  3. 创建自定义序列

    • 在弹出的对话框中,输入所需的排序顺序,如按姓氏的首字母排序。
    • 点击“添加”,然后点击“确定”。
  4. 应用排序

    • 返回“排序”对话框,选择刚创建的自定义序列,点击“确定”进行排序。

通过自定义排序,可以根据特定规则或顺序对姓名列进行排序,满足不同需求。

三、使用公式辅助

在某些情况下,可能需要更加灵活的排序方式,此时可以使用Excel公式进行辅助排序。

  1. 插入辅助列

    • 在原数据旁边插入一列,用于存放辅助排序的公式。
  2. 输入公式

    • 在辅助列中输入公式,如=SORTBY(A2:A10, B2:B10),其中A2:A10是姓名列,B2:B10是辅助排序的列。
  3. 复制公式

    • 将公式复制到整个辅助列中,使其应用于所有姓名。
  4. 排序数据

    • 根据辅助列的值,对原数据进行排序。

使用公式可以实现更加复杂的排序需求,如根据多个条件进行排序,提高数据管理的灵活性。

四、利用数据透视表

数据透视表是Excel中强大的数据分析工具,也可以用于对姓名列进行排序。

  1. 插入数据透视表

    • 选择包含姓名列的整个数据范围,点击“插入”选项卡,选择“数据透视表”。
  2. 设置数据透视表字段

    • 将姓名列拖动到数据透视表的“行标签”区域。
  3. 排序数据

    • 在数据透视表中,右键点击姓名列,选择“排序”,然后选择“升序”或“降序”。

通过数据透视表,可以快速对大数据集中的姓名列进行排序,同时还可以进行其他复杂的数据分析。

五、利用筛选功能

在处理较大数据集时,筛选功能也可以用于按姓名排序。

  1. 启用筛选功能

    • 选择包含姓名列的整个数据范围,点击“数据”选项卡,选择“筛选”。
  2. 排序数据

    • 点击姓名列标题旁边的下拉箭头,选择“排序A到Z”或“排序Z到A”。
  3. 查看结果

    • 数据将按姓名列进行排序,方便查找和管理。

筛选功能不仅可以用于排序,还可以用于过滤和查找特定数据,提高工作效率。

六、使用宏自动排序

对于经常需要排序的工作,可以编写宏来自动化排序过程。

  1. 打开宏编辑器

    • 按Alt + F11打开VBA编辑器。
  2. 编写排序宏

    Sub SortByName()

    Range("A1:B10").Sort Key1:=Range("A1"), Order1:=xlAscending, Header:=xlYes

    End Sub

  3. 运行宏

    • 关闭VBA编辑器,返回Excel,按Alt + F8选择并运行宏。

通过宏可以自动化排序过程,减少手动操作,提高工作效率。

七、使用第三方插件

有些第三方插件可以提供更高级的排序功能。

  1. 安装插件

    • 安装并启用所需的第三方插件。
  2. 选择排序功能

    • 在插件菜单中选择相应的排序功能。
  3. 应用排序

    • 根据需要设置排序条件,应用排序。

第三方插件可以提供更多的排序选项和功能,满足特定需求。

八、数据清理与预处理

在进行排序之前,确保数据的清洁和一致性非常重要。

  1. 删除空白行

    • 删除姓名列中的空白行,确保数据连续。
  2. 检查重复项

    • 使用“删除重复项”功能,确保姓名列中没有重复数据。
  3. 标准化姓名格式

    • 确保姓名列中的数据格式一致,如统一大小写和拼写。

通过数据清理和预处理,可以提高排序的准确性和有效性。

九、常见问题及解决方法

在排序过程中,可能会遇到一些常见问题,以下是解决方法:

  1. 姓名排列错误

    • 检查数据范围是否正确选择,确保所有相关列都包含在内。
  2. 数据错位

    • 确保在排序时选择整个数据范围,而不仅仅是姓名列。
  3. 排序不生效

    • 检查排序条件和设置,确保选择正确的列和排序方式。

通过以上方法,可以有效解决排序过程中遇到的常见问题,提高数据管理的准确性和效率。

十、排序后的数据分析

排序后,可以进行进一步的数据分析。

  1. 数据统计

    • 使用“数据透视表”或“数据分析工具”进行统计分析。
  2. 图表展示

    • 使用“插入图表”功能,将排序后的数据以图表形式展示,便于理解和分析。
  3. 报告生成

    • 根据排序和分析结果,生成详细的报告,为决策提供支持。

通过排序后的数据分析,可以更好地理解数据,做出科学的决策。

综上所述,在Excel表中按姓名进行排序的方法多种多样,包括使用排序功能、自定义排序、公式辅助、数据透视表等。选择合适的方法,可以提高工作效率,确保数据的准确性和一致性。

相关问答FAQs:

1. 如何在Excel表中按照姓名进行排序?
在Excel中按照姓名进行排序非常简单。您可以按照以下步骤操作:

  • 首先,选中包含姓名的列(例如A列)。
  • 其次,点击Excel菜单栏中的“数据”选项卡。
  • 然后,选择“排序”功能。
  • 接下来,在排序对话框中,选择要排序的列(例如A列)。
  • 最后,选择“升序”或“降序”选项并点击“确定”按钮即可完成按姓名排序。

2. Excel表格中的姓名如何进行升序排序?
如果您想按照姓名进行升序排序,您可以按照以下步骤进行操作:

  • 首先,选中包含姓名的列(例如A列)。
  • 其次,点击Excel菜单栏中的“数据”选项卡。
  • 然后,选择“排序”功能。
  • 接下来,在排序对话框中,选择要排序的列(例如A列)。
  • 最后,选择“升序”选项并点击“确定”按钮即可完成按姓名升序排序。

3. 怎样在Excel表格中按照姓名进行降序排序?
如果您想按照姓名进行降序排序,您可以按照以下步骤进行操作:

  • 首先,选中包含姓名的列(例如A列)。
  • 其次,点击Excel菜单栏中的“数据”选项卡。
  • 然后,选择“排序”功能。
  • 接下来,在排序对话框中,选择要排序的列(例如A列)。
  • 最后,选择“降序”选项并点击“确定”按钮即可完成按姓名降序排序。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4746439

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部